Hot Spiced Cider

Ingredients
- 1 quart fresh apple cider
- 1 tablespoon light brown sugar
- 1 cinnamon stick
- 1 teaspoon cloves
- 1 teaspoon ground allspice
- 1/8 teaspoon ground mace
- Pinch of kosher salt
- Pinch of cayenne pepper
Details
Servings 6
Preparation
Step 1
Combine the apple cider, sugar, cinnamon, cloves, allspice, mace, salt, and cayenne in a large saucepan and bring just to a simmer, stirring occasionally. Reduce the heat to low and simmer for 2 minutes. Remove from the heat and let sit for 1 hour to macerate.
Strain the mixture into a clean saucepan (discard the solids) and return to a simmer. Serve warm in tall coffee mugs.
